From verse to moving ink

1. Name the beat

You bring a saga moment: the first lift of Mjolnir, the Bifrost burning underfoot, a quiet watch on Asgard’s wall. We lock pose, weather, and how much of the page the panel is allowed to eat.

2. Ink, colour, hold

Pencils stay on the board in Milton until the anatomy and hammer-weight feel right. Inks follow, then colour keys for Asgardian dusk or Midgard hail. Motion is a short loop, never a cartoon that fights the linework.

3. Issue the comic

You receive print-resolution stills, the animated panel file, and a single NFT comic edition transferred to your wallet. The studio keeps the working boards; you keep the issued piece.
